Four hundred yards of fence is to be used to endose a rectangular area next to a straight river. The river bank acts as one side of the rectangle, and the fence is used to make the other three sides ofthe rectangle. Suppose the width w in yards of the rectangle is along the river bank.(a) Express the height of the rectangle in terms of w.b) Express the area of the rectangle in terms of w.

400 yards of fence = total fencing

400 = 2 widths + 2 heights

Since one side (width) is along the river, and the river bank acts as one side of the rectangle, the fence will be used in 3 sides:

400 = w+2h

Solving for h:

400-w=2h

(400-w)/2 = h

h= (400-w)/2 (a)

h= 200-1/2w (simplified)

To express the area:

Area of a rectangle : height x width

Since h = 200-1/2w

A = (200-1/2w) w

A = 200w-1/2w^2 (b)
